From Taipei to Sun Moon Lake
Use Taichung as the transfer point—not the final destination. Take high-speed rail to THSR Taichung, then continue directly to the lake by tourist shuttle.
Recommended route
Reserve a southbound HSR train from Taipei to Taichung. Leave transfer time rather than choosing a tight connection.
At Exit 5, go down to the first-floor bus terminal and use Platform 3 for the Taiwan Tourist Shuttle Sun Moon Lake Route. The bus journey is about 90 minutes.
Shuishe Visitor Center is the practical arrival point for boats, bicycle rental and local buses. Check the return service before heading around the lake.
